What are the best ways to manage Dactylitis?
Dactylitis, a condition causing swelling of fingers and toes, is best managed through a combination of medication, physical therapy, and lifestyle modifications. Seek specialized care from a rheumatologist for tailored treatment and support. Early intervention is key to managing Dactylitis effectively.
What co-existing conditions are common with Dactylitis?
Dactylitis is often associated with conditions such as psoriatic arthritis, ankylosing spondylitis, and sickle cell disease. Seeking specialized care from a rheumatologist or a healthcare provider experienced in treating inflammatory joint conditions is crucial for managing Dactylitis effectively.
